Repetition is essential with your parrot and you will need to do this simple maneuver several times so that your parrot fully trusts you. Once they trust you they are less likely to bite you when your hand goes into the cage. Although there will be times when your parrot is simply not in the mood and may bite through anger or frustration. If this is the case then leave the training and go back to it at another time. You have to get to know your parrot so you can tell when they are unwell or simply moody. Understanding why they are behaving the way they are will benefit both you and your parrot. A little bit of time spent training parrots not to bite will go a long way towards having a wonderful relationship with your parrot in the long run.
